Kanji 踠

To favorites
Radical: (157)
Strokes: 15
On:
エン、オン、ワ
en, on, wa
Kun:
かが.む、もが.く
kaga.mu, moga.ku
Reading in names:
-
Meanings:
write, struggle, be impatient

Examples

藻掻く
もがく
mogaku
to struggle;to writhe;to wriggle;to squirm; to act franticly;to make desperate efforts
踠き
もがき
mogaki
struggle;writhing;wriggling;floundering
もがき苦しむ
もがきくるしむ
mogakikurushimu
to writhe in agony
